按类别查询搜索结果
关于关键词 "Python" 的检测结果,共 52
思月行云 | 2017-03-29 13:45:36 | 阅读(0) | 评论(0)
http://blog.csdn.net/liuxingyu_21/article/details/23427801 今天在WingIDE下写了个脚本,传到服务器执行后提示: -bash: /usr/bin/autocrorder: /usr/bin/python^M: bad interpreter: No such file or directory 分析: 这是不同系统编码格式引起的:在windows系统中编辑的.sh .py文件可能有不可见字符,所以在Linux系统下执行会报以上【阅读全文】
lyy_wt | 2016-11-18 14:52:16 | 阅读(30) | 评论(0)
leolmf | 2016-10-17 16:43:44 | 阅读(300) | 评论(0)
1、module和package 1.1 模块module module就是一个.py文件 xxx.py可以直接被import 同级目录可以import xxx 也可用sys.path.append()临时添加路径,来import其他目录下的xxx.py 1.2 包packages packages就是一个文件夹(一般要有__init__.py,root包可以不要),其中包括多个module 以包的形式import -aaa |-__init__.【阅读全文】
王斌bingo | 2016-09-27 17:23:34 | 阅读(120) | 评论(0)
python编辑xls工具 https://github.com/BillWang139967/XLSWriter 【阅读全文】
王斌bingo | 2016-09-26 09:55:03 | 阅读(90) | 评论(0)
https://github.com/BillWang139967/jump_menu 当管理的机器比较多时,使用jump_menu是个好的选择【阅读全文】
王斌bingo | 2016-09-25 23:14:38 | 阅读(90) | 评论(0)
https://github.com/BillWang139967/py_menu python终端配置菜单,操作非常方便 一级目录和二级目录可以修改config.py ,方便的显示。 一级和二级菜单分别是独立的程序,新增菜单项,无需修改一级和二级的程序。只需添加对应的三级程序即可 第三层目录可以方便设置,程序已经将第三层目录封装为json 欢迎使用【阅读全文】
老爷康 | 2016-08-29 14:02:05 | 阅读(300) | 评论(0)
最近在写一个命令行的实现,需要自己处理用户的各种输入,包括一些类似上下左右的功能键 第一步:1、设置标准输入为raw模式 利用了tty模块的setraw 函数,可以在lib下面查看tty.py 其实tty模块就是有两个函数setraw 和 setcbreak tty模块主要依赖termios 模块,而termios 模块(/Modules/termios.c)就是把我们termios的C函数接口转换成了模【阅读全文】
老爷康 | 2016-08-27 19:18:27 | 阅读(270) | 评论(0)
基本编译流程是按照下面来的 http://www.ahlinux.com/embed/7577.html 编译成功后,运行在arm下基本正常,但是有几个问题 1、导入egg的第三方库提示 zipimport.ZipImportError: can't decompress data; zlib not available 这个问题就是说python不支持zlib解压 如何解决, 1、在源码 python2.7.3/Modules/Setup.dist 搜索zlib 【阅读全文】
王斌bingo | 2016-08-20 20:27:55 | 阅读(150) | 评论(0)
str='python String function' 生成字符串变量str='python String function' 字符串长度获取:len(str) 例:print '%s length=%d' % (str,len(str)) 字母处理 全部大写:str.upper() 全部小写:str.lower() 大小写互换:str.swapcase() 首字母大写,其余小写:str.capitalize() 首字母大写:str.titl【阅读全文】
老爷康 | 2016-08-19 15:38:48 | 阅读(120) | 评论(0)
王斌bingo | 2016-07-04 00:13:48 | 阅读(300) | 评论(0)
列表合并 用list的extend方法,L1.extend(L2),该方法将参数L2的全部元素添加到L1的尾部,例如: >>>L1=[1,2,3,4,5] >>>L2=[20,30,40] >>>L1.extend(L2) >>>L1 [1,2,3,4,5,20,30,40] 比较容易记忆的是用内置的set 【阅读全文】
王斌bingo | 2016-07-04 00:08:16 | 阅读(390) | 评论(0)
python使用set来去重是一种常用的方法. 一般使用方法如下: # int a = [1, 2, 3, 4, 5, 1, 2, 3, 4, 5, 6, 7, 8, 9, 0] print "orginal:", a print list(set(a)) # str 【阅读全文】
woaimaidong | 2016-04-24 19:41:31 | 阅读(60) | 评论(0)
**(604657***)10:10:22 学python对以后运维的工作很重要吗 LAMP(812711277)10:11:07 如虎添翼 加薪的筹码 **(604657***)10:11:40 感谢 LAMP(812711277)10:16:32 我的理解, 运维的学会一门语言,收益如下: 1)开发技能 2)抽象解决问题的思维方式 3)增强了与开发团队沟通的纽带 4)理解问题、分析问题高度提高了 【阅读全文】
王斌bingo | 2016-04-24 18:29:56 | 阅读(0) | 评论(0)
python类的用法 第一种方法: 全选复制放进笔记 class OneObjectCreater(): pass 第二种方法带有类的参数 全选复制放进笔记 class TwoObjectCreater(object): pass 都使用print出来,却有细微的差别; 全选复制放进笔记 if __name__ == "__main__": print OneObjectCreater() prin【阅读全文】
zhiye_wang | 2016-04-22 14:03:23 | 阅读(0) | 评论(0)
python实现LDAP用户名密码认证 1 python实现LDAP用户名密码认证,来实现统一认证 点击(此处)折叠或打开 #!/usr/bin/python import ldap ldap_user = "Manager" ldap_pwd = "secret" 【阅读全文】
【LINUX】 python之装饰器
王斌bingo | 2016-03-28 22:15:28 | 阅读(30) | 评论(0)
装饰器是程序开发中经常会用到的一个功能,用好了装饰器,开发效率如虎添翼,所以这也是python面试中必问的问题,但对于好多小白来讲,这个功能 有点绕,自学时直接绕过去了,然后面试问到了就挂了,因为装饰器是程序开发的基础知识,这个都 不会,别跟人家说你会python, 看了下面的文章,保证你学会装饰器。 1、先明白这段代码 #【阅读全文】
【LINUX】 python with
王斌bingo | 2016-03-17 21:07:02 | 阅读(30) | 评论(0)
python’s with statement provides a very convenient way of dealing with the situation where you have to do a setup and teardown to make something happen. A very good example for this is the situation where you want to gain a handler to a file, read data from the file and the close the file handler. 有一些任务,可能事【阅读全文】
王斌bingo | 2016-03-13 23:21:46 | 阅读(0) | 评论(0)
python自动创建数据库以及数据库中的表 import MySQLdb conn = MySQLdb.connect(host = 'localhost', port = 3306, user = 'root', passwd = '*****') curs = conn.cursor() try: curs.execute('create database addtest') except: print 'Database addtest exists!' conn.select_db('addtest') # create a table named addfie【阅读全文】
【LINUX】 python TCP编程
王斌bingo | 2016-03-12 13:17:34 | 阅读(0) | 评论(0)
python tcp编程 1、TCP连接的建立方法 客户端在建立一个TCP连接时一般需要两步,而服务器的这个过程需要四步,具体见下面的比较。 步骤 TCP客户端 TCP服务器 第一步 建立socket对象 建立socket对象 【阅读全文】
王斌bingo | 2016-03-07 10:38:27 | 阅读(0) | 评论(0)
python获取网页的状态码 第一种是用urllib模块: import urllib status=urllib.urlopen("http://www.baidu.com").code print status 第二种是用requests模块: import requests code=requests.get("http://www.baidu.com").status_code print code【阅读全文】